Use buttons
Probably the easiest way to take a screenshot is to use the buttons. Press the Volume Down and Power buttons and keep them pressed until the screenshot is saved. You can use this method to screenshot with scroll.

Google Assistant
The laziest option is to use Google Assistant. Just say OK Google and then Take a screenshot. The phone will do all the work for you.

How do I share my screenshots? Depending on the Android version and the built-in shell, sending screenshots may differ. In recent versions of Android (9 or 10), the quick actions menu will arise after you take a screenshot instantly. There you need to select the appropriate icon for sharing. Or just open the gallery app on your phone.
Where are screenshots stored? If you can't find the screenshots you made, don't give up. The places where the phone saves screenshots and regular photo may be different. Again, it all depends on custom shells. A pure Android throws pictures into the gallery (DCIM). Other shells can save screenshots to a different folder for your usability.
